Description

Suicidal thoughts can seem like they will last forever – but these thoughts and feelings pass with time. This app is designed to support those dealing with suicidal thoughts and help prevent suicide. Having a plan in place that can help guide you through difficult moments can help you cope and keep you safe. A safety plan is designed so that you can start at the beginning and continue through the steps. You can customize your own warning signs that a crisis may be developing, coping strategies for dealing with suicidal urges, places for distraction, friends and family members you can reach out to, professionals you can call, methods of making your environment safe, and your own important reasons for living. If following your safety plan is not enough to stem a suicidal crisis, then this app also contains an easy-to-access list of emergency resources so that help is just a tap away. For long-term recovery, we provide a thorough guide to dealing with suicidal thoughts. I had & have outstanding mental health care by the VA. However, a safety plan on a sheet of paper, upon leaving the hospital or in the course of outpatient treatment, is not practical. It’ll get lost, destroyed in the laundry, the dog will eat it, it might be shredded accidentally, or just plain wear out. Most people carry around their cell phone. This app is easy to use, wise to have, has a great layout, & was thoughtfully designed. I recommend you review your plan every 3 months & write down what changes you think your plan needs then review with your psychotherapist before updating it. If you don’t have the energy to devote to updating it (yes, depression can do that), talk it out every 3 months with your psychotherapist (you are worth it, darn it!).
